 Thomson 100 Top Hospitals

March 2008 – Grandview Medical Center is named in the Thomson® (formerly Solucient) 100 Top
Hospitals roster, listed as one of 25 teaching hospitals that received the nation’s top scores in quality, safety and
efficiency.

 Dayton’s Best Places to Work Awards

March 2008 – Grandview and Southview, as member hospitals of Kettering Health Network, are named two of "Dayton’s Best Places to Work" by the Dayton Business Journal (DBJ). This recognition comes from the positive responses of Network employees who voluntarily take the DBJ Best Places to Work survey.
 HealthGrades

January 2008 – Grandview and Southview are the only Dayton hospitals and one of only 63 American hospitals to earn the Distinguished Hospital Award from HealthGrades for five consecutive years (2004-2008). The award places Grandview and Southview Hospitals in the top five percent for overall clinical quality.
October 2007 – Grandview Medical Center receives multiple 2008 HealthGrades Five-Star distinctions for treatment of heart failure, heart attack, stroke, overall pulmonary care, pneumonia, bowel obstruction, sepsis, respiratory failure and diabetic acidosis and coma.
2007 - Five-star rated by HealthGrades for treatment of stroke and heart failure as well as the only hospitals in the Dayton central area to be ranked among the top five percent in the nation for overall pulmonary care and among the top 10 percent for GI services.
